India's services sector growth slowed to its lowest level in four-and-a-half years in July, as softer domestic and export demand, along with intense competition, weighed on business activity, according to the latest HSBC India Services PMI survey.
The HSBC India Services PMI Business Activity Index declined to 53.3 in July from 57.4 in June, marking the weakest expansion in 53 months. Although the index remained above the 50-mark, indicating continued growth, the pace of expansion moderated significantly.
The survey noted that new business inflows increased at a slower pace amid weakening demand conditions and competitive pressures, resulting in the slowest growth in services activity since early 2022.
